In 2010, Bayliss Boatworks implemented Valsoft DockMaster as its core Maritime ERP. The deployment introduced Valsoft DockMaster to support parts, service and financial workflows across the organization. Bayliss Boatworks acquired eight DockMaster licenses and deployed Valsoft DockMaster to departmental users including the stock room, accounting team, the boatyard manager and the service writer. Functional capabilities in use map to inventory control for the stock room, accounting and financial transaction recording for the accounting group, boatyard operations management for the boatyard manager, and service writing and job management for technicians and service staff. The implementation replaced Intuit Quickbooks Enterprise for the company financial workflows while extending transactional and inventory control into operational areas. License distribution and cross-department adoption indicate a seat-based deployment model with centralized transactional records and role-based access controls to coordinate parts, service orders and accounting entries through Valsoft DockMaster Maritime ERP.

In 2016, Bayliss Boatworks implemented Microsoft 365 to deliver Collaboration capabilities across the organization. Bayliss Boatworks implemented Microsoft 365 as its core Collaboration platform to support internal communication, document management, and day to day productivity for a 94 person U.S. manufacturing operation, and the Microsoft 365 deployment is referenced on the company website. The implementation was provisioned as a cloud hosted Microsoft 365 tenant providing standard Collaboration modules including Exchange Online email, SharePoint document libraries, OneDrive for Business file storage, Microsoft Teams messaging and meetings, and Office desktop and web applications. Deployment and operational scope covered production, design and administrative business functions, with tenant level administration and centralized account management used to control access and user provisioning. Governance focused on centralized administration and user account controls to align collaboration workflows with shop floor and back office processes, while the public site references confirm Microsoft 365 is in active use for the company.

In 2021, Bayliss Boatworks deployed WooCommerce on its public website. WooCommerce serves as the company's eCommerce platform, powering the online storefront, shopping cart and checkout workflows. The implementation centers on product catalog management, checkout and payment configuration, shipping rules, and order management via the WooCommerce administrative interface. Frontend theming and CMS integration present product pages and technical information alongside marketing content, while administrative roles were configured to give sales and operations staff control over listings, pricing, and customer orders. Operational scope covers the website sales channel for Bayliss Boatworks, supporting order capture and fulfillment processes that align with manufacturing and shipping operations. Integrations are limited to the WooCommerce stack implemented on the site, with order processing and customer communication managed through in-platform workflows and admin controls for governance of product, pricing, and fulfillment.
